Confirmed Exoplanet Discovered 2014

Kepler-332 b

A rocky terrestrial orbiting the k-type orange Kepler-332, located approximately 1,122.6 light-years from Earth.

Key parameters at a glance

  • A radius of 1.17 Earth radii
  • A mass of 1.71 Earth masses
  • Surface gravity around 1.25 g
  • An orbital period of 7.626 days
  • Semi-major axis 0.0700 AU
  • Equilibrium temperature 703 K (430 °C)
  • Distance from Earth 1,122.60 light-years
  • Earth Similarity Index 0.452
  • Travel time at Voyager 1 speed 19,796,985 years
  • Almost certainly tidally locked to its host star given the close orbit

2 siblings around Kepler-332

Kepler-332 b shares its host star with 2 other confirmed planets. Side-by-side measurements below.

Planet Type Radius (R⊕) Mass (M⊕) Period (d) Eq. T (K) Year
Kepler-332 b this Rocky Terrestrial 1.17 1.71 7.626 703 2014
Kepler-332 c Rocky Terrestrial 1.09 1.32 15.996 550 2014
Kepler-332 d Rocky Terrestrial 1.18 1.76 34.212 427 2014
